Lucerne Valley, California is a small rural town located in the High Desert region of Southern California. It is known for its vast and scenic desert landscape, as well as its close proximity to popular outdoor destinations such as Big Bear Lake and Joshua Tree National Park. With a population of just over 5,000 people, it is a tight-knit community with a slower pace of life. However, like any place, there are pros and cons to living in Lucerne Valley.
